# OpenProvHop Deep Research

An AI-powered research assistant that performs iterative, deep research on any topic by combining web search, content analysis, and large language models.

**🔬 Simple yet powerful research automation in Python**

The goal is to provide the simplest implementation of a deep research agent that can refine its research direction over time and dive deep into any topic. Optimized for ease of use and understanding.

## Features

- **🔄 Iterative Research**: Performs deep research by iteratively generating search queries, processing results, and diving deeper based on findings
- **🎯 Intelligent Query Generation**: Uses LLMs to generate targeted search queries based on research goals and previous findings
- **⚙️ Depth & Breadth Control**: Configurable parameters to control research scope (breadth: 1-20, depth: 1-10)
- **🔮 Smart Follow-up**: Generates follow-up questions to better understand research needs
- **📊 Web Dashboard**: Beautiful web interface with real-time progress tracking and organized result tabs
- **🔗 API Server**: REST API for integration with other applications
- **🚀 Concurrent Processing**: Handles multiple searches and result processing in parallel
- **🤖 Multiple AI Providers**: Support for NVIDIA, OpenAI, Fireworks AI, OpenRouter, and local models
- **✨ Advanced Features**:
  - **Semantic Re-ranking**: Orders results by relevance using sentence transformers
  - **Smart Deduplication**: Removes near-duplicate content automatically  
  - **Freshness Filtering**: Prioritizes recent information (configurable)
  - **Provenance Tracking**: Transparent source attribution with supporting snippets and confidence scores

## AI Model Providers

The system automatically selects the best available model in this order:

1. **Custom Model** - if `CUSTOM_MODEL` and `OPENAI_ENDPOINT` are set
2. **DeepSeek R1** (OpenRouter) - if `OPEN_ROUTER_KEY` is set
3. **NVIDIA Llama 3.1 70B** - if `NVIDIA_API_KEY` is set
4. **DeepSeek R1** (Fireworks) - if `FIREWORKS_KEY` is set
5. **GPT-4o-mini** (OpenAI) - Fallback option

## Advanced Features

### Enhanced Search Quality

The system includes advanced retrieval processing for higher quality results:

- **Semantic Re-ranking**: Orders search results by relevance using AI embeddings
- **Smart Deduplication**: Automatically removes near-duplicate content (configurable threshold)
- **Freshness Filtering**: Prioritizes recent information while filtering outdated content

**Configuration:**
```bash
USE_RERANKING=true        # Enable processing (default: true)
DEDUP_THRESHOLD=0.9       # Similarity threshold (default: 0.9)
MIN_YEAR=2020            # Minimum document year (default: 2020)
```

### Provenance Tracking

Every research finding includes transparent source attribution:

- **Source URLs**: Direct links to original documents
- **Supporting Snippets**: Exact 1-2 sentence excerpts supporting each learning
- **Confidence Scores**: Similarity scores showing reliability (0-100%)
- **Matched Terms**: Key terms found in supporting evidence

**Example Output:**
```markdown
### Learning #1
**Finding:** Python 3.12 introduces improved error messages

**Source:** "Python 3.12 now provides more detailed error messages..."
**From:** https://docs.python.org/3.12/whatsnew
**Confidence:** 95%
```

**Access Provenance Data:**
```python
from src.deep_research import deep_research

result = await deep_research("Your query", breadth=4, depth=2)

if result.learnings_with_provenance:
    for provenance in result.learnings_with_provenance:
        print(f"Learning: {provenance['learning']}")
        print(f"Source: {provenance['source_url']}")
        print(f"Evidence: {provenance['supporting_snippet']}")
        print(f"Confidence: {provenance['confidence_score']:.1%}")
```

## How It Works

The research process follows these steps:

1. **Query Analysis** - Takes user query and generates follow-up questions for refinement
2. **Search Generation** - Creates multiple targeted SERP queries based on research goals  
3. **Content Retrieval** - Searches web using Firecrawl API and scrapes relevant pages
4. **Quality Enhancement** - Applies semantic re-ranking, deduplication, and freshness filtering
5. **Learning Extraction** - Analyzes content to extract key insights and learnings
6. **Provenance Tracking** - Links each learning to supporting source snippets with confidence scores
7. **Iterative Deepening** - Generates new research directions and repeats if depth > 0
8. **Report Generation** - Compiles findings into comprehensive markdown reports

```mermaid
flowchart TB
    Q[User Query] --> DR[Deep Research]
    DR --> SQ[Generate SERP Queries]
    SQ --> SR[Search & Scrape]
    SR --> QE[Quality Enhancement]
    QE --> LE[Extract Learnings]
    LE --> PT[Track Provenance]
    PT --> D{Depth > 0?}
    D -->|Yes| RD[Generate Directions]
    RD --> DR
    D -->|No| R[Generate Report]
```

## Performance & Rate Limits

### Firecrawl Rate Limits

Configure concurrency based on your plan:

```bash
# Free tier
FIRECRAWL_CONCURRENCY=1

# Paid tier or self-hosted
FIRECRAWL_CONCURRENCY=5
```

### Performance Tips

- **Start small**: Use `breadth=2, depth=1` for testing
- **Monitor rate limits**: Watch for 429 errors and adjust concurrency
- **Use faster models**: NVIDIA models are generally quicker
- **Self-host Firecrawl**: For unlimited scraping

## Troubleshooting

### Common Issues

| Issue | Solution |
|-------|----------|
| "No model found" error | Ensure at least one AI provider API key is set |
| Rate limit errors | Reduce `FIRECRAWL_CONCURRENCY` or upgrade Firecrawl plan |
| Empty search results | Check Firecrawl API key and connectivity |
| Import/dependency errors | Run `pip install -r requirements.txt` |
| Slow processing | Enable GPU, use smaller parameters, or faster model |
